MGM has a good room with plenty of tables and short wait lists. I got seated within 5 minutes and played 3/6. Players were friendly and knowledgable. I didn't like the marble table in front of the seats. They just feel cold and hard.
Players at my table were solid. I was getting real crap cards like 7-2o 8-3o and such, so I played until I was down my limit and picked up to get some dinner.
Didn't really stay long enough to cycle through many dealers. The ones that were there were good.
I don't recall the cocktail waitress.
Management is good. No problems that I saw.
Didn't really stay long enough to get a feel for the comps. If I recall there is no bonus for high hands but someone mentioned that they are considering it.
